Installed solar energy capacity in Belize
Belize: Installed solar energy capacity was 0.007 gigawatts in 2024. ◆ Volatile
Installed solar energy capacity in Belize, 2000–2024
Source: IRENA (2025) – processed by Our World in Data. Measured in gigawatts.
Analysis
In 2024, installed solar energy capacity in Belize stood at 0.007 gigawatts. That is the highest value across all 25 years on record.
That represents a change of up 907.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, installed solar energy capacity in Belize peaked at 0.007 gigawatts in 2023 and was at its lowest, 0 gigawatts, in 2000.
That places Belize 178th out of 218 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the bottom qu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

About this data
Total solar (on- and off-grid) electricity installed capacity, measured in gigawatts. This includes solar photovoltaic and concentrated solar power.
